LEMONGRASS SYRUP RECIPE – Afrolems Nigerian Food Blog



Lemongrass syrup is what I often use for pancakes, puff puffs, drink mixes and more. It is so versatile that it can also be used for ice cream. Benefits of lemongrass

  • Lemongrass has several antioxidant properties.
  • It also has some antibacterial properties, which means it fights bacteria, especially in the mouth.
  • Lemongrass promotes healthy digestion, especially when taken as tea.
  • It is also a great diuretic that means you urinate often enough when you drink lemongrass tea.

I would like to emphasize that the method of consuming lemongrass is also important for achieving these characteristics. I don’t know how many of the above properties are effective for lemongrass syrup. I used it primarily because of the scented nature of the plant, but it can be consumed in other ways.

Lemongrass syrup recipe

material

A handful of lemongrass

2 glasses of water

1 cup of granulated sugar

Method

Rinse the lemongrass until all sand and impurities are completely removed.

Put lemongrass and water in a pan and simmer on medium heat for 5-7 minutes.

Turn off the heat and soak for 15 minutes.

When it boils, there should be about a glass of lemongrass liquid left. Therefore, weigh the liquid of lemongrass with an equal amount of sugar and bring it to a boil.

Stir and bring to a boil until the sugar is completely dissolved and the liquid is thick.

Let it cool, then bottle it and put it in the refrigerator. It can be used for pancakes, puff puffs, and ice cream.

Note: Lemongrass can be left in the liquid for one day and taken out the next day to maximize the flavor. However, remove it after 24 hours so that the syrup does not become bitter.
